Religious Teachers Committee
Launched In Tutong
Bandar Seri
Begawan – Some 200 religious teachers in the Tutong District
attended the launch of the formation of the Tutong District Religious
Teachers Committee recently at the Seri Kenangan Hall, Tutong District
Community Centre.
Cikgu
Nooralizam bin Hj Idris was elected the chairman of the 441-member
committee.
Among the aims of the association is
to expose teachers to current technology and ICT literacy issues.
It is also aimed at encouraging
teamwork spirit and fostering ties among the members.
The launch was officiated by
Assistant Director of Islamic Studies, Ministry of Education Hj Aji
bin Hj Ishak, who later handed mementos and certificates of
appreciation to retired teachers and teachers who taught Primary 6
between 2003 and 2004.
Hj
Aji also handed a memento to Tutong District Islamic Studies Officer
Sheikh Hj Abd Khalid bin Sheikh Hj Yahya, which concluded the event.
